.cart-s.svelte-1dzh0mp.svelte-1dzh0mp{position:fixed;width:100%;height:100%;top:0;left:0;z-index:1050;pointer-events:none}.cart-s.svelte-1dzh0mp .overlay.svelte-1dzh0mp{opacity:0;z-index:-1;background-color:#000;transition:opacity .3s;width:100%;height:100%;top:0;left:0;position:fixed}.cart-s.svelte-1dzh0mp .sidebar.svelte-1dzh0mp{position:relative;width:100%;max-width:640px;right:-100%;background:#fff;transition:right .4s;z-index:2}.cart-s.visible.svelte-1dzh0mp.svelte-1dzh0mp{pointer-events:all}.cart-s.visible.svelte-1dzh0mp .overlay.svelte-1dzh0mp{opacity:.4;z-index:1}.cart-s.visible.svelte-1dzh0mp .sidebar.svelte-1dzh0mp{right:0}
